The chief witness at this hearing was Texas Governor Rick Perry. Also testifying were U.S. Customs and Border Patrol’s Chief Patrol Agent of the Rio Grande Valley Sector Kevin Oaks, Director of the Texas Department of Public Safety Steve McCraw, Interim Sheriff of Hidalgo County Eddie Guerra, Judge Ramon Garcia of Hidalgo County, and Bishop Mark Seitz of the Catholic Diocese of El Paso.
Both Governor Perry and local officials laid the blame for the crisis on the Obama Administration, both for failing to physically secure the Texas border and for sending the message that those who successfully crossed would be allowed to stay.
